Yes.
Each customer (company) account with us can have multiple users, as each customer (company) with us has a customer number this can be used to link users to a company. Each user will have their unique log in. When applying it can be decided which users require different access (price, stock and place orders or price and stock only). The users will be linked using the customer numbers so shipping and invoice addresses are available at checkout.
As an existing customer you can apply for an account here.